Section 1: Historical Use of Objective and Projective Terms

Objective and projective terms have been used to classify personality tests historically. The objective approach refers to a test that utilizes clear and unambiguous stimuli to measure personality traits. In contrast, the projective approach uses ambiguous stimuli to elicit responses that provide insight into a person’s personality (Meinert, 2015).
